Installation Process

Setting up an indoor cat door is a reasonably simple process that requires some basic DIY skills and tools. Here's a step-by-step guide to assist you get going:

Tools Needed:
Drill and bitsScrewdriver and screwsDetermining tapeLevelPencil and markerSecurity glasses and a dust mask (optional)
Step 1: Choose the Perfect Location

When choosing the ideal area for your indoor cat door, think about the following factors:
Traffic: Choose a location with very little foot traffic to avoid accidents and tension.Accessibility: Ensure the location is quickly accessible for your cat, and ideally near a food source or litter box.Climate: Avoid locations with severe temperatures, wetness, or drafts.
Step 2: Measure and Mark the Door

Step the width of your cat door and mark the center point on the wall or door frame. Utilize a level to make sure the mark is directly, and a pencil to draw a line along the length of the door.

Action 3: Cut Out the Door

Utilize a drill and bits to cut out a hole for the cat door, following the maker's directions for size and shape.

Step 4: Install the Door Frame

Install the door frame, ensuring it is level and secure. Use screws to connect the frame to the wall or door frame.

Step 5: Add the Door Panel

Connect the door panel to the frame, following the maker's instructions for assembly and installation.

Action 6: Test the Door

Evaluate the door to guarantee it is functioning properly, and make any necessary adjustments to the positioning or tension.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How do I select the best size cat door for my pet?

A: Measure your cat's width and height to determine the perfect door size. Talk to the producer or a pet expert for guidance.

Q: How do I avoid drafts and wetness from getting in through the cat door?

A: Install a weatherproof seal or limit to reduce drafts and wetness. Regularly clean and maintain the door to avoid damage.

Q: Can I set up an indoor cat door in a load-bearing wall?

A: It is suggested to prevent setting up cat doors in load-bearing walls, as this can jeopardize the structural stability of your home. Talk to a professional if you're unsure.

Q: How do I keep other animals or bugs from getting in through the cat door?

A: Install a secure locking system or use a magnetic closure system to avoid unwanted entry. Think about adding a screen or mesh to keep insects and insects out.
